Little update: still hanging around duke pediatric bone marrow transplant unit waiting for everything to line up. There are tons of work up tests they have to do followed by a collaborative idea of what he looks like going into another transplant. Tuesday he goes under again so they can add a third central line/iv (he only has two and they need at least 3 this time), another bone marrow biopsy, and a lumbar puncture to check spinal fluid. Hopefully by Thursday well have our ducks in a row and have an idea of how hes held up. Then, a few days later ( maybe the following Monday?), well begin conditioning which consists of really high dose chemo for 10 days to clear out any stem cells in his bone marrow so he can get an unrelated cord blood transplant. They use a countdown system so the process starts on day -10, -9, -8 and so on until day 0 which is transplant day. Then we celebrate small victories on day +30, etc. In the meantime, his body is not making new cells yet from the round of chemo he completed over a month ago at home so his immune system is on vacation. So hes spiked a fever, picked up a cough and tested positive for a virus. Not a happy camper overall but not due to feeling bad rather he is on strict isolation from the other kids so he cant leave his room to play, socialize, or get exercise. If i leave his room even to use the restroom its gloves, mask and contact gown...fun. Hopefully the fevers clear and eventually hell be off isolation but the doctor says his body is in no shape to create antibodies and clear the virus soon enough to be off isolation the entire time....thats months stuck in a room.
